Back when I was a student at Pomona College, I used to do news reports for KSPC-FM, 88.7, the student radio station. One of the damned few real college radio stations left, since so many have gone over to NPR.

My boss back then, a friend and one of the smartest people I've ever met, was Gordon Robison. He went on to do things like write Lonely Planet's Arab Gulf States book (including photography, at which he's very good), and broadcast and produce for ABC Radio and CNN from places like Cairo, and Amman, and similar points in the region.

I'm pleased to say I just found his new blog/website -- Mideast Analysis.com

Mind you, he's sold his soul to the devil, as he's about to go off to be Fox News' bureau chief in Baghdad for seven weeks.

Still... If anyone could make Fox a bit more reality-based, it's Gordon.
